Property Details for 55 Palmerston St, Mosman Park

55 Palmerston St, Mosman Park is a 5 bedroom, 4 bathroom House with 4 parking spaces and was built in 1915. The property has a land size of 1910m2 and floor size of 367m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in May 2025.

About Mosman Park 6012

The size of Mosman Park is approximately 4.3 square kilometres. There are 37 parks, covering nearly 29.9% of the total area. The population of Mosman Park in 2016 was 8757 people. By 2021 the population was 9169 showing a population growth of 4.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mosman Park is 50-59 years. Households in Mosman Park are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mosman Park work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 63.60% of the homes in Mosman Park were owner-occupied compared with 61.50% in 2016.

Mosman Park has 4,468 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Mosman Park have seen a 52.11%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 78.20% increase. As at 30 June 2026:
